AI tools for writing
AI writing tools are designed to assist with content creation, editing, and ideation across different formats and platforms. They can generate articles, improve grammar, and help structure ideas more effectively.
Popular tools include:
ChatGPT – for content generation, brainstorming, and editing
Jasper – for marketing content and brand-focused writing
Grammarly AI – for grammar, tone, and clarity improvements
These tools help writers move faster while maintaining quality and consistency.

AI tools for design
Design tools powered by AI are making it easier to create high-quality visuals without advanced design skills or extensive experience in the field. They assist with layouts, image generation, and creative direction.
Common tools include:
Canva AI – for quick designs, presentations, and social media content
Adobe Firefly – for AI-generated images and creative assets
Figma AI features – for collaborative UI/UX design enhancements
These tools allow designers and non-designers alike to create visuals efficiently.
Automation and workflow tools
Automation tools connect different applications and streamline repetitive processes, reducing manual work across teams.
Examples include:
Zapier – automates workflows between apps
Make (Integromat) – builds complex automation scenarios
Notion AI – combines knowledge management with automation
By integrating these tools, teams can create seamless workflows that save time and improve productivity across multiple projects and environments.
Choosing the right stack
Selecting the right combination of tools depends on your workflow and goals as well as your team size and needs. Not every tool is necessary, and using too many can create unnecessary complexity.
When choosing tools, consider:
Ease of use and learning curve
Integration with your existing systems
Specific features that match your needs
Cost and scalability over time
Starting small and expanding gradually is often the most effective approach.
